base |
the part that supports something or that something stands on. |
bath |
the act of sitting in water and cleaning yourself. |
greet |
to use words or simple actions that show pleasure or respect when you meet someone or start a letter. |
heap |
many things lying on top of each other; pile. |
height |
the distance from the bottom to the top. |
key |
a metal object cut in a special way so it can open or close locks. |
lean1 |
to bend in a certain direction. |
log |
a large, thick piece of a tree that has been cut down and is ready for sawing, burning, or building. |
order |
a direction or command. |
route |
a road or way of travel from one place to another. |
sap |
the liquid that carries nutrients and water to all parts of a plant. |
shape |
the form of the outer surface or edge of an object. |
sweat |
to give off a liquid through the skin. |
ugly |
not pleasant to look at. |
wake1 |
to come out of sleep (often followed by "up"). |
